How to Increase Bone Density at 21: A Young Adult's Guide

2 min read

Did you know that you reach your peak bone mass in your late teens and early 20s, with some overall gains continuing until about age 30? While many think of bone health as a concern for older adults, the lifestyle choices you make at 21 are critical for building a strong skeletal foundation for life.

Why Focus on Bone Density at 21?

Reaching peak bone mass, typically in your late 20s or early 30s, is crucial for future skeletal health. A higher peak provides a greater reserve against bone loss that starts after 30, particularly important for women post-menopause. Age 21 is a key time to maximize bone strength through current habits.

The Nutritional Cornerstones of Strong Bones

Nutrition is fundamental for bone density, requiring more than just calcium.

Calcium: More Than Just Dairy

Adults need 1,000 mg of calcium daily. Sources include:

  • Dairy products (milk, yogurt, cheese)
  • Leafy greens (kale, broccoli)
  • Fortified foods (cereals, plant-based milks)
  • Canned fish with bones (sardines, salmon)
  • Nuts and seeds (almonds, sesame seeds)
  • Soy products (tofu, edamame)

Vitamin D: Calcium's Best Friend

Vitamin D is essential for calcium absorption. Adults aged 19-70 need 600-800 IU daily. Sources include sunlight, oily fish, egg yolks, beef liver, and fortified foods. Supplements may be necessary; consult a doctor.

Other Supporting Nutrients

Magnesium, potassium, protein, and vitamin K also support bone health.

The Impact of Weight-Bearing Exercise

Exercise strengthens bones, especially weight-bearing and resistance training which work against gravity.

Weight-bearing exercises: Walking, jogging, hiking, jumping rope, stair climbing, dancing, aerobics, sports.

Resistance exercises: Weightlifting, resistance bands, bodyweight exercises, yoga, Pilates.

Comparison of Exercises for Bone Density

Exercise Type Examples Bone Density Benefit Additional Benefits
High-Impact Weight-Bearing Running, jumping, tennis, dance High Cardiovascular health, muscle strength, agility
Low-Impact Weight-Bearing Brisk walking, hiking, elliptical machine Moderate Gentle on joints, improves cardiovascular health
Resistance Training Weightlifting, resistance bands, bodyweight exercises High Increases muscle mass and strength, improves posture
Non-Weight-Bearing Swimming, cycling Low Excellent for cardiovascular fitness, low joint impact

Lifestyle Factors for Lifelong Bone Health

Healthy lifestyle choices are also important.

  • Maintain a Healthy Body Weight: Both being underweight and overweight negatively impact bone health.
  • Limit Alcohol Intake: Excessive alcohol hinders calcium absorption and affects bone formation.
  • Quit Smoking: Tobacco use accelerates bone loss.
  • Avoid Excessive Caffeine and Soda: High cola consumption may lower bone density.

The Long-Term Perspective

Building high peak bone mass in your 20s protects against age-related bone loss and osteoporosis later. This proactive approach is more effective than trying to regain lost bone.
